What Is a Tip (Gratuity)?
A tip, or gratuity, is a sum of money given to service workers as a token of appreciation for their service. It is typically expressed as a percentage of the total bill, allowing customers to reward good service accordingly.
How to Tip?
To tip fairly, consider the quality of service you received. A standard guideline is to tip between 15% to 20% for satisfactory service. For exceptional service, consider tipping more, and for less satisfactory service, you may choose to tip less, but it’s always good practice to leave something.

What is 8 percent of a $46 bill?
To calculate 8 percent of a $46 bill, multiply 46 by 0.08, which equals $3.68.
How do I calculate a tip percentage?
To calculate a tip percentage, divide the tip amount by the total bill amount and multiply by 100. For example, if your tip is $3.68 on a $46 bill, the calculation is (3.68 / 46) * 100 = 8%.
